I refer to the Minister for Energy's announcement of 26 August 2009 that the Government would not remerge Verve and Synergy, and I ask:
(a) is this still the policy position of the Government;
(b) if not, on what date did the Government's policy position change; and
(c) on what date did the Government announce that it had changed its policy position?

(a - c) The Government has not made any decision to remerge Verve Energy and Synergy.
